Perfect Square
47485881 is a perfect square (6891 × 6891)
Forty-seven million, four hundred and eighty-five thousand, eight hundred and eighty-one.
47485881 is a perfect square (6891 × 6891)
47485881 is odd
Previous odd number is 47485879
Next odd number is 47485883
Sunday, 04 July 1971 14:31:21 UTC